Fix `sandbox::Memory` lifecycle + sandox get memory function for no_std env (#845)
* Fix `sandbox::Memory` lifecycle for no_std env * Retain memories in env_def builder and instance * Add scoped memory creation to test RC semantics * Add deploying_wasm_contract_should_work test. * Fix sandboxed memory set function.
Showing
- substrate/Cargo.lock 2 additions, 0 deletionssubstrate/Cargo.lock
- substrate/core/executor/src/wasm_executor.rs 2 additions, 2 deletionssubstrate/core/executor/src/wasm_executor.rs
- substrate/core/executor/wasm/src/lib.rs 15 additions, 3 deletionssubstrate/core/executor/wasm/src/lib.rs
- substrate/core/sr-sandbox/without_std.rs 31 additions, 13 deletionssubstrate/core/sr-sandbox/without_std.rs
- substrate/node/executor/Cargo.toml 2 additions, 0 deletionssubstrate/node/executor/Cargo.toml
- substrate/node/executor/src/lib.rs 186 additions, 7 deletionssubstrate/node/executor/src/lib.rs
Please register or sign in to comment